From the creator of SatireWire.com, the hysterical, award-winning Web site that "unite(s) The Onion and the Wall Street Journal in a marriage of pure lunacy" (Fast Company) comes a sizzling spoof of the breathless business journalism America has grown to distrust.
Through his hugely popular Web site Andrew Marlatt has hilariously skewered America's marketing moguls, double-talking executives, and the sharky venture capitalists who seemed so omnipotent in the 1990s and so out-to-lunch in the 2000s. Now, Economy of Errors showcases Marlatt's on-the-mark parodies of nine years of corporate kookiness and the business journalists who put their spin on it.
